signed · Nebraska · Legislature May 13, 2025

LB 419: Change provisions relating to admission to veterans homes and veterans aid

LB 419 updates Nebraska's laws to make eligibility rules for veterans homes and veterans aid more consistent. It clarifies that veterans, their spouses, and surviving family members must meet specific requirements to qualify, including two years of Nebraska residency, proof of need for care due to service, age, or disability, and income limits. The bill also sets clear rules for applying for aid, allowing only one application every 30 days and ensuring state funds are used exclusively for direct assistance - not for organizing veterans groups. These changes streamline the process for veterans seeking support while maintaining existing eligibility standards.
